## Overview

A Reddit user documents firsthand how LLMs generate confidently presented but statistically unrepresentative summaries of customer feedback, revealing a core tension between AI's coherence optimization and empirical fidelity.

### TL;DR

- User observed LLMs fabricating 'top objections' from Reddit reviews with high confidence despite low actual frequency (e.g., 2/200 comments)
- The issue is not falsehood but narrative smoothing — prioritizing coherent-sounding answers over data-supported representativeness
- Current mitigation requires manual spot-checking of raw inputs, undermining AI's time-saving promise

### Key Stats

- **2** — comments supporting claimed top objection. Out of 200 sampled comments; cited as evidence of representativeness failure

## Narrative Mechanics

**Function:** deflect_scrutiny  

### The Spin in Plain English

The post frames LLM inaccuracies not as failures but as predictable side effects of how they're built — making the problem feel familiar, human-scale, and solvable with simple habits like spot-checking.

**What the story wants you to believe:** That LLM 'insight' is best understood as narrative smoothing — a known, manageable artifact of design — not a sign of broken or unsafe systems.  

**What it makes harder to question:** Whether coherence-driven distortion constitutes a fundamental limitation for high-stakes analytical use cases where statistical validity is non-negotiable.  

**How the Spin Works:** Combines first-person authority ('I did this, I saw this') with accessible metaphor ('smoothing', 'sounds right') to normalize a serious technical limitation. It makes the coherence bias feel smaller and more controllable than its architectural roots warrant — while the validation gap (no model specs, no reproducible metrics) remains unaddressed.
